Data

Big Data Architect

Looking to hire your next Big Data Architect? Here’s a full job description template to use as a guide.

About Vintti

Vintti is a staffing agency with a unique mission: to create win-win scenarios for both US businesses and Latin American professionals. We address the challenges faced by SMBs, startups, and firms in finding the right talent, as well as the aspirations of skilled Latin American workers seeking international opportunities. By bridging this gap, Vintti enables US companies to access a wealth of untapped talent, while providing Latin American professionals with pathways to expand their careers on a global scale. Our approach cultivates a symbiotic ecosystem that benefits all parties involved.

Description

A Big Data Architect is a vital role focused on designing and implementing data processing frameworks and infrastructure to manage, analyze, and extract valuable insights from large and complex datasets. They ensure data solutions are scalable, efficient, and aligned with business objectives. Responsibilities typically include selecting appropriate data platforms, optimizing data storage, and facilitating seamless data integration. They work closely with data engineers, analysts, and stakeholders to translate business requirements into robust data architectures, driving data-driven decision-making across the organization.

Requirements

- Bachelor's or Master's degree in Computer Science, Information Technology, or related field.
- Proven experience as a Big Data Architect or similar role.
- Proficiency with big data tools and technologies such as Hadoop, Spark, Kafka, and NoSQL databases.
- Strong understanding of data warehousing concepts and ETL processes.
- Experience in designing and developing scalable data architectures.
- Proficient in programming languages such as Java, Scala, or Python.
- Expertise in SQL and data querying languages.
- Familiarity with cloud platforms and services (e.g., AWS, Azure, Google Cloud).
- Strong knowledge of data modeling, data integration, and data governance.
- Experience with data security and compliance requirements.
- Ability to optimize data solutions for performance and cost-efficiency.
- Excellent collaboration and communication skills.
- Proven ability to work in a fast-paced, cross-functional team environment.
- Strong problem-solving and analytical abilities.
- Experience in conducting proof of concept (PoC) projects.
- Understanding of machine learning and data analytics concepts.
- Familiarity with containerization and orchestration tools (e.g., Docker, Kubernetes) is a plus.
- Ability to mentor and provide technical guidance to junior team members.
- Strong documentation skills for architectural designs and processes.
- Willingness to engage in continuous learning to stay updated with industry advancements.

Responsabilities

- Design and architect big data solutions and frameworks.
- Implement scalable and efficient data pipelines and ETL processes.
- Collaborate with data scientists, engineers, and analysts to understand and meet data requirements.
- Assess and select appropriate big data technologies and tools.
- Develop strategies for data storage, processing, and retrieval.
- Ensure data systems are secure and compliant with regulatory standards.
- Provide technical guidance and mentorship to junior team members.
- Monitor and optimize performance, scalability, and cost-efficiency of data solutions.
- Troubleshoot and resolve issues in big data systems.
- Document architecture, processes, and system configurations comprehensively.
- Conduct proof of concept initiatives for emerging technologies and methodologies.
- Participate in code reviews and enforce best practices and standards.
- Plan for capacity and resource management in big data environments.
- Continuously evaluate and refine existing data systems and workflows.
- Stay updated with industry trends and advancements in big data technologies.

Ideal Candidate

The ideal candidate for the Big Data Architect role will possess a Bachelor's or Master's degree in Computer Science, Information Technology, or a related field, with significant proven experience in big data architecture and demonstrated proficiency in major big data tools and technologies such as Hadoop, Spark, Kafka, and NoSQL databases. They will have a deep understanding of data warehousing concepts, ETL processes, and the ability to design and develop scalable data architectures using advanced programming languages like Java, Scala, or Python. They will be adept at SQL and data querying languages, with familiarity in cloud platforms and services such as AWS, Azure, or Google Cloud. The ideal candidate will excel in data modeling, data integration, governance, and possess strong knowledge of data security, compliance, and optimization for performance and cost-efficiency. Their exceptional collaboration and communication skills will enable them to work effectively in cross-functional teams, understand complex data requirements, and provide clear technical guidance and mentorship to junior team members. They will have a strong analytical and problem-solving capability, high attention to detail, and capacity to perform under pressure while managing multiple projects. This proactive and self-motivated individual will demonstrate leadership, adaptability, a commitment to continuous learning, and innovation. Their strategic thinking, organizational prowess, and ability to translate complex technical concepts to non-technical stakeholders will set them apart, alongside a passion for big data technologies and a dedication to delivering high-quality, results-driven outcomes.

On a typical day, you will...

- Design, develop, and implement big data solutions to support complex data analytics requirements.
- Collaborate with cross-functional teams including data scientists, data engineers, and business analysts to understand data requirements and translate them into scalable architectures.
- Evaluate and select appropriate big data tools and technologies such as Hadoop, Spark, Kafka, and NoSQL databases.
- Develop and maintain data pipelines to ensure efficient data ingestion, processing, and storage.
- Optimize data solutions for performance, scalability, and cost-efficiency.
- Ensure data security and compliance with relevant data protection regulations.
- Provide technical guidance and mentorship to junior team members and developers.
- Monitor and troubleshoot data systems to ensure high availability and reliability.
- Document architecture designs, processes, and configurations for reference and training.
- Conduct proof of concept (PoC) projects to evaluate new technologies or approaches.
- Participate in code reviews and provide feedback to ensure adherence to best practices and standards.
- Perform capacity planning and resource management for big data environments.
- Continuously evaluate and implement improvements to existing big data systems and workflows.
- Engage in continuous learning to stay current with advancements in big data technologies and best practices.

What we are looking for

- Strong analytical and problem-solving skills
- Excellent communication and collaboration abilities
- Proven leadership and mentorship capabilities
- High level of adaptability and learning agility
- Strong attention to detail and precision
- Ability to work well under pressure and manage multiple projects concurrently
- Self-motivated and proactive mindset
- Commitment to continuous improvement and innovation
- Strong strategic thinking and long-term vision
- High degree of accountability and reliability
- Demonstrated passion for big data technologies and methodologies
- Ability to translate complex technical concepts to non-technical stakeholders
- Strong organizational and time-management skills
- Driven by results and quality of work
- Candidate should be a team player while also being able to work independently

What you can expect (benefits)

- Competitive salary range commensurate with experience
- Comprehensive health, dental, and vision insurance
- 401(k) retirement plan with company match
- Generous paid time off (PTO) and holidays
- Flexible working hours and remote work options
- Professional development opportunities including conferences, certifications, and training programs
- Employee wellness programs and resources
- Parental leave and family support benefits
- Life and disability insurance
- Employee assistance program (EAP) for mental health and wellness support
- Onsite fitness facilities or gym membership reimbursement
- Relocation assistance if applicable
- Opportunities for career advancement and internal promotions
- Access to cutting-edge technologies and tools
- Collaborative and inclusive company culture
- Stock options or equity opportunities
- Commuter benefits or transportation reimbursement
- Company-sponsored social events and team-building activities

Vintti logo

Do you want to find amazing talent?

See how we can help you find a perfect match in only 20 days.

Big Data Architect FAQs

Here are some common questions about our staffing services for startups across various industries.

More Job Descriptions

Browse all roles

Start Hiring Remote

Find the talent you need to grow your business

You can secure high-quality South American talent in just 20 days and for around $9,000 USD per year.

Start Hiring For Free